当前位置:首页 > 道理详解  >  文章正文

数值计算方法课程感悟-课程收获与数值计算感悟

2 / 2026-06-05 03:10:33 道理详解
数数算数背后的逻辑之美与工程价值

数值计算方法课程虽名为“数算”,实则是连接离散数学理论与复杂工程实践的桥梁。在计算机科学飞速发展的当下,这门课程不仅教会我们如何利用算法解决具体的计算问题,更让我们深刻体会到严谨逻辑在解决现实难题中的核心地位。从简单的循环遍历到庞大的数值积分,从经典算法优化到前沿的机器学习训练,整个学习过程是一趟从理论到实践、从概念到应用的深度探索。它让我明白,代码不仅是指令的执行工具,更是人类理性思维的算法化表达。每一行代码的编写、每一次调试的失败,都是在与复杂系统博弈的过程中,强化对确定性规律的理解。这门课程真正的价值,不在于掌握了几个具体的函数或函数库,而在于培养了面对抽象问题时的结构化思维框架,掌握了将物理世界转化为计算机可理解模型的能力。这种能力的培养,让我们在面对不确定性时,依然能通过数学规律寻找最优解,这或许正是人工智能与自动化时代赋予人类的独特能力。 基础算法与数值逼近的真实场景

学习数值计算方法,首先必须建立对“近似即真理”这一核心思想的认知。在真实世界中,许多现象无法通过精确解析获得,或者解析过程极其复杂。此时,数值计算方法便成为了通往真实世界的唯一路径。为了理解这一点,我们可以看一个极具代表性的例子:计算大气中的温度分布。由于云朵和大气湍流的影响,大气温度随高度变化的方程往往是非线性的,且其边界条件极其复杂,无法用简单的公式表示。
因此,科学家和工程师转而使用数值迭代的方法,将空间离散化,将时间离散化,最终通过一系列简单的循环运算来逼近真实的温度场。这个过程看似枯燥,实则是将复杂的自然规律转化为程序代码的典范。
除了这些以外呢,在金融领域,汇率的波动和风险的预测也是典型的数值问题。由于这些因素具有高度的随机性和非线性,传统的精确解往往不存在,只能依靠蒙特卡洛模拟等方法,通过大量随机采样来估算期望值和风险概率。这些案例表明,数值方法是现代科学计算不可或缺的工具,它让人类能够量化和理解那些曾经不可捉摸的现象。 优化算法与效率提升的博弈

随着计算对象规模的扩大,单纯通过增加硬件算力已难以满足需求,因此算法的优化成为了数值计算课程中至关重要的部分。如何用最少的运算步数得到最好的结果?如何避免在计算过程中陷入局部最优而忽略全局最优?这些问题直指算法的核心。例如在图像识别任务中,卷积神经网络(CNN)的权重更新往往依赖于大量的梯度下降迭代。如果没有高效的梯度下降算法,模型的收敛速度将极慢,推理时间也会变得过长。
因此,课程中涉及了几何优化算法、牛顿法、共轭梯度法等技巧。这些方法通过引入特定的数学结构,显著减少搜索空间的维度,加速收敛过程。在实际编程中,这意味着我们精心设计的不仅是对应复杂问题的算法,更是决定系统性能的关键因素。一个高效的优化策略,往往能带来成倍提升的执行效率,这对于实时控制系统、大规模数据分析和高频交易系统等对性能要求极高的领域而言,具有决定性的意义。
因此,深入理解优化算法的数学原理与实现细节,是掌握数值计算精髓的关键。 并行计算与分布式系统的挑战

现代数值计算的另一个重要发展方向是并行计算,即如何利用多核处理器或分布式集群资源来加速计算任务。
这不仅是算力的堆砌,更是对算法和网络通信的深度结合。在大规模气象模拟中,一次完整的预报可能需要数万亿次浮点运算,这超出了单台超级计算机的处理能力。于是,学术界和工业界纷纷探索并行策略,如MPI(消息传递接口)、OpenMP(多线程)以及GPU加速计算。这些算法的核心在于如何将一个巨大的计算问题分解为多个子任务,同时考虑到不同任务之间的数据依赖关系,以避免内存带宽成为瓶颈。
例如,在求解大型线性方程组时,可以将矩阵分块,对每个块进行并行计算,最后通过线程同步结果。这一过程对程序设计能力提出了极高要求,必须深入理解线程通信机制、内存分配策略以及网络拓扑结构。
于此同时呢,并行计算还带来了新的挑战,如负载均衡和死锁问题,这些都需要编写者具备极强的架构思维。
除了这些以外呢,云计算和分布式存储技术的发展,使得我们将计算任务分发到云端服务器成为常态,这也要求我们必须掌握异构计算、资源调度等高级概念,以适应未来算力云爆发的趋势。 前沿算法与人工智能的融合

随着人工智能领域的迅猛发展,传统的数值计算方法正在经历深刻的变革,与深度学习、强化学习等前沿技术深度融合,催生出了一系列全新的算法体系。这些算法不再局限于传统的矩阵运算和梯度下降,而是更多地结合了图神经网络(Graph Neural Networks)和基于采样蒙特卡洛搜索的策略。
例如,在推荐系统中,利用图神经网络可以捕捉物品之间复杂的关联关系,而不仅仅是特征向量的相似度,这种基于图结构的数值方法极大地提升了挖掘能力。在物理模拟中,离散粒子动力学方法结合数值积分技术,能够在极低的时间步长下准确模拟分子碰撞和晶体生长过程。这些前沿应用展示了数值计算的无限潜力。它们不仅改变了我们处理数据的方式,也为解决气候变化、能源危机等全球性挑战提供了新的技术路径。
例如,在天气预报中,传统方法已经难以在纳秒级时间内生成高保真的预测,而基于代理模型的数值方法则可以在保证精度的同时大幅缩短计算时间。这意味着,未来的数学家、算法工程师和数学家将成为解决复杂系统问题的主力军,他们的价值将体现在对前沿算法的洞察与应用上。 总结与展望

总体而言,数值计算方法课程不仅是一门关于算法的学科,更是一门关于逻辑与工程的科学。通过对基础算法的掌握、优化技巧的钻研、并行策略的探索以及前沿技术的融合,我们不仅提升了解决具体问题的能力,更培养了面对未知问题的坚韧心态和结构化思维。从简单的循环迭代到复杂的模拟仿真,从单机计算到云端协同,数值计算始终是人类理性不断突破局限的伟大实践。在未来的科研与工作中,我们将继续深化对这些算法的理解,探索更高效的计算方法,为解决日益复杂的实际问题提供强有力的技术手段。这门课程赋予我们的,不仅是代码和函数,更是一种驾驭技术、洞察规律、创造未来的核心能力。无论时代如何变迁,数算背后的逻辑之美与工程价值,都将永恒闪耀。

注意事项:

部分资源可能会出现广告/收费服务/VIP课程等内容,请自行甄别,以免上当受骗。

本篇资源由【小木应用文】收集自互联网,仅供学习参考使用,请勿用于其他用途!

转载请标明出处,谢谢。

  • 窗边的小豆豆道理50字-窗边小豆豆道理

    9 / 2026-05-25 道理详解

    金句:窗边的小豆豆道理、窗边的五步成长法、窗边的小豆豆"画饼"论与窗边的小豆豆“偏爱”心,概括了教育需尊重个体差异、通过倾听引导孩子潜能爆发、以积极心态看待差异、以及建立平等、真诚的师生关系。 窗边

  • 团队用心工作感悟-团队精神感悟心得

    8 / 2026-05-25 道理详解

    团队用心工作感悟 团队用心工作感悟综合 在当今瞬息万变的商业环境中,个体竞争已不再是主流,团队协作与内心驱动力成为了决定组织成败的关键因素。团队用心工作不仅仅是一种行为准则,更是一种能够激发无限

  • 心理咨询师爱情感悟-咨询师情感体验

    7 / 2026-05-25 道理详解

    心理咨询师爱情感悟的综合 心理咨询师在运用专业助人技巧处理来访者心理困扰时,极易陷入一种特殊的心理共鸣,这种现象在专业领域被称为“情感共鸣”或“移情效应”。当咨询师与来访者在潜意识层面建立起深刻

  • 职场生活感悟心得-职场感悟心得

    7 / 2026-05-25 道理详解

    职场生活感悟心得综合 在当今瞬息万变的商业环境中,职场生活早已超越了单纯的工作岗位范畴,它是一场关于认知、成长与平衡的漫长修行。作为现代职场人,我们不仅要应对繁重的业务指标,更要处理复杂的人际关

  • 西游记50字感悟-西游记感悟

    6 / 2026-05-25 道理详解

    西游记五字感悟综合 《西游记》作为中国古典文学的巅峰之作,其魅力不仅在于描绘了玄奘大师西行求法的壮举,更在于通过孙悟空、猪八戒、沙僧等八位主要人物,构建了一个波澜壮阔的奇幻世界。这部小说深刻反映